React Native Elements

React-Native-Elements is a cross-platform mobile UI toolkit and component library designed for the React Native framework. It provides a system of pre-styled visual components to build consistent user interfaces across mobile and web platforms using a single shared codebase.

The framework enables the development of applications that run across different operating systems and web browsers while maintaining a unified look and feel. It supports rapid UI prototyping and application design by providing reusable building blocks that reduce the need to create every custom component from scratch.
